The US Navy (USN) Wasp Class Amphibious Assault Ship USS BONHOMME RICHARD (LHD 6) sails along downtown Seattle as part of the 55th Annual SEAFAIR Parade of Ships. SEAFAIR is Seattle's month-long traditional summer festival, which includes the parade of ships, parades, amateur athletics, air shows, and boat racing
